Book Description
The dawn of 1964 was greeted by a disillusioned nation still in mourning over the recent death of President John F. Kennedy. It was a year marked by both hope and sadness. Presidential successor Lyndon B. Johnson's vision of a Great Society buoyed the nation but the murder of three civil rights workers and the start of the Vietnam War kept the country in a state of unrest.
